About PayRecs & the Role 

PayRecs is a B2B payment solution for regional and super-regional banks and their commercial customers, delivering new revenue streams, leaner operations, and a best-in-class user experience. Our mission: International treasury made simple. Unprecedented transparency, simplicity, predictability.

As a critical member of our engineering team, you’ll architect, build, and scale our multi-tenant payments platform end-to-end—driving high availability, security, and performance in a production environment

We're looking for a Senior Software Engineer to join our Engineering team. In this role, you will build innovative payments products that delight both financial institutions and their customers. As an early member of the engineering team, you will help shape the engineering culture of a fast-growing startup.

What You'll Do

  • Design & Build: Develop secure, scalable microservices and front-end features using Node.js, React, and GraphQL.
  • Frameworks & Architecture: Define frameworks and patterns that ensure codebase maintainability, testability, and rapid iteration.
  • Cross-Functional Collaboration: Partner with Product, Design, and QA to translate customer needs into technical solutions, from spec through deployment.
  • Ownership & Mentorship: Lead complex projects, guide junior engineers, and foster a culture of continuous learning and improvement.
  • Performance & Reliability: Identify and resolve bottlenecks, optimize queries, and ensure 99.9% uptime across AWS services (EC2, RDS, S3, Lambda).

What You’ll Bring

  • 5+ years of software engineering experience building large-scale, high-availability systems
  • Strong proficiency in our core stack: TypeScript/JavaScript, Node.js, React, GraphQL (Apollo), and SQL (MySQL)
  • AWS expertise: Hands-on production experience with EC2, RDS, S3, Lambda, CloudFormation/CloudWatch
  • API Design: Proven track record designing and consuming RESTful and GraphQL APIs; third-party integrations
  • Quality & Testing: Skilled with Jest/Mocha, CI/CD pipelines, and automated end-to-end tests
  • Communication & Collaboration: Excellent written and verbal skills; ability to work closely across disciplines

Nice to Haves

  • Banking or fintech industry experience
  • Containerization & orchestration (Docker, Kubernetes)
  • Security best practices and compliance (SSAE, SOC2)
  • Experience with payment rails (ACH, SWIFT, ISO 20022)
  • Front-end testing frameworks (Playwright)
